void usage (void)
{
fprintf (stderr, "\nUsage: pvput [options] <PV name> <values>...\n\n"
" -h: Help: Print this message\n"
" -v: Print version and exit\n"
"\noptions:\n"
" -r <pv request>: Request, specifies what fields to return and options, default is '%s'\n"
" -w <sec>: Wait time, specifies timeout, default is %f second(s)\n"
" -t: Terse mode - print only successfully written value, without names\n"
" -p <provider>: Set default provider name, default is '%s'\n"
" -q: Quiet mode, print only error messages\n"
" -d: Enable debug output\n"
" -F <ofs>: Use <ofs> as an alternate output field separator\n"
" -f <input file>: Use <input file> as an input that provides a list PV name(s) to be read, use '-' for stdin\n"
" enum format:\n"
" default: Auto - try value as enum string, then as index number\n"
" -n: Force enum interpretation of values as numbers\n"
" -s: Force enum interpretation of values as strings\n"
"\nexample: pvput double01 1.234\n\n"
, DEFAULT_REQUEST, DEFAULT_TIMEOUT, DEFAULT_PROVIDER);
}
